Charmander, the Lizard Pokémon, is a beloved Fire-type Pokémon introduced in Generation I. It is one of the three Kanto starter Pokémon, evolving into Charmeleon and then the iconic Charizard. Charmander is characterized by the flame on its tail, which is said to be a measure of its life force; if the flame goes out, Charmander perishes. This unique characteristic makes it a poignant and memorable creature. In the wild, Charmander are typically found in hot, mountainous regions, preferring warm climates that complement their fiery nature. Their diet likely consists of small insects or berries.
